Overview Element has an opportunity for a Mechanical Technician (2nd Shift) to join our growing team. This is a great opportunity to develop your career within a Global TIC business.
Salary:
$20- $24/hr
DOE Hours:
2nd Shift, training on 1st shift ! Responsibilities Interpretation of internal and client requirements Supervising allocated staff and being responsible for the day to day management of the relevant discipline Operating complex mechanical testing equipment Maintaining accurate and systematic records Performing other duties to fulfil the demands of the laboratory Performing general duties in accordance with Element's internal procedures, quality as well as Health and Safety system Application of instrumentation and the setting up of complex data capture equipment Report writing, data interpretation and analysis Skills / Qualifications Educated to a good general standard including English and Maths Degree level or equivalent in Mechanical Engineering or another relevant materials related discipline Hands-on job Sound mechanical bias Previous experience in an appropriate Engineering environment is a distinct advantage Experience of working within a Mechanical testing environment is advantageous An understanding of a recognised Quality Management Systems such as
ISO 17025
is beneficial Self motivated Technician with the ability to multi task, organise and work under the pressure of a busy commercial mechanical test laboratory Excellent attention to detail Strong written and verbal communication skills A team player attitude Excellent analytical and problem solving skills Company Overview Element is one of the fastest growing testing, inspection and certification businesses in the world.
